Almost any home in the United States will need heat at some point. Even those who live in the southern most states have a need for heat on occasion, usually in the evening or overnight. When it comes to heating you have many options, but if you are looking to save some money, you might want to consider a wood burning stove. These are often the cheapest form of heat for a home, but they do require some work and maintenance.

There are two kinds of wood burning stove you can buy. The most common kind is in the home, and the other kind is outside. My parents opted for an outdoor stove to save money, but it is more complicated than an indoor stove. The stove itself is outside, but you need to have heating ducts and vents installed in the house.

The wood is put into the fire outside, and an electrical motor blows the heat through the ducts. Because my parents have an unlimited supply of free wood, this was a great choice for them.

Even if you don’t have free wood, you may find buying wood for a wood burning stove to be inexpensive, and it can be delivered to your home.

A Wood burning stove isn't just for homes. Many won’t use the indoor version because it can be messy, and they don’t like the smoke that can come with using one. Some people use both the indoor and outdoor version to heat garages and other detached buildings.

This saves them from the expense of installing an electric or oil burning heating system, and is very easy to maintain. They do require some cleaning, but cleaning is often quick and easy, if not a little messy.

If you are considering wood burning stoves, you can find them in most home stores, and online.

If you shop at a home store, you can have a salesperson help you when you choose a model. There are different sizes, and they can help you choose one for your house size and your particular needs. If you don’t want to mess with wood, you can find a wood burning stove that use pellets instead of wood.

These are small, and quite often very effective at heating a small home. For a larger home, you may have to get two units. With the rise cost of gas, many families are looking into these because they are small, safe, cheap, and easy to use.
